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kilmaurs to Thorpe-le-Soken start from as little as £45.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kilmaurs to Thorpe-le-Soken start from £104.60 one way, or £219.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kilmaurs to Thorpe-le-Soken are available for £133.30 one way, or £452.40 return

Facilities at Kilmaurs Station

While it may not come equipped with a ticket office, Kilmaurs ensures passengers can efficiently manage their journeys with accessible ticket machines available on-site. These machines allow passengers to purchase tickets and collect those bought online. For those with accessibility needs, you’ll be pleased to know that Kilmaurs provides an accessible ticket machine and features such as induction loops. Although staff help isn't available, customer help points and screens displaying departure information make navigation straightforward. Despite the lack of toilets or refreshment options, Kilmaurs station does deliver on providing essential services like CCTV for safety and free car parking for travelers. The car park boasts 20 spaces, with two spaces specially reserved for Blue Badge holders.

Facilities and Amenities

At Thorpe-le-Soken Station, travelers have access to basic yet essential amenities. Although there is no ticket office, ticket machines are available to facilitate a seamless ticket-purchasing experience. The machines are user-friendly, accepting card payments, and are equipped with induction loops for accessibility.

While the station itself does not provide refreshments or shopping outlets, nearby facilities can cater to other needs. Waiting rooms are available for those looking to relax before their train journey, operational from Monday to Friday between 6:30 AM and 11:00 PM. Accessibility features are somewhat limited; the station does not offer step-free access, so those with mobility challenges might consider nearby alternatives at Clacton-on-Sea or Kirby Cross stations.
